’How to Write an Essay’ is a book of lessons, model essays and writing topics to help students between Grades 5 and 12 to practise their essay writing technique. The book looks at story writing, short essays, information, explanation, discussion and argumentative essays, letters to friends, business letters, letters to the editor, science reports, job application letters and curriculum vitae, writers’ techniques, poetry and prose analysis. If students attempt most of the essays in the book, they are bound to become better writers as a result of all their efforts.

This comprehensive English book provides lessons and exercises for a wide range of students, including secondary pupils in Grades 7 and 8, advanced ESL students, and more senior pupils needing revision of basic skills. This final book in the series revises the parts of speech, and then progresses to advanced grammar, punctuation, sentence analysis and parsing. More complex exercises are provided in comprehension, spelling, vocabulary, conversation and writing technique, including poetry analysis. This book is ideal for home study, but is also suitable for the mixed-ability, multicultural class
